Across generations, 'Joretta' has shown interesting popularity patterns: Among the Silent Generation (1928-1945), it ranked 1262nd out of 9204 names. Among the Baby Boomers (1946-1964), it ranked 2925th out of 12526 names. Among the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980), it ranked 7887th out of 19264 names. "Joretta" Popularity Across American Generations
Generation | Gender | Rank | Total Names |
---|---|---|---|
Silent Generation (1928-1945) | Girl | 1262nd of 9204 | 655 |
Baby Boomers (1946-1964) | Girl | 2925th of 12526 | 300 |
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980) | Girl | 7887th of 19264 | 78 |
